							- package azure
 
- import (
 
- 	"context"
 
- 	"testing"
 
- 	"github.com/Azure/azure-sdk-for-go/profiles/2019-03-01/resources/mgmt/resources"
 
- 	"github.com/Azure/azure-sdk-for-go/profiles/preview/preview/subscription/mgmt/subscription"
 
- 	"github.com/Azure/go-autorest/autorest/to"
 
- 	"github.com/pkg/errors"
 
- 	"github.com/stretchr/testify/mock"
 
- 	"github.com/stretchr/testify/suite"
 
- 	"github.com/docker/api/context/store"
 
- 	. "github.com/onsi/gomega"
 
- )
 
- type ContextSuiteTest struct {
 
- 	suite.Suite
 
- 	mockUserSelector       *MockUserSelector
 
- 	mockResourceGroupHeper *MockResourceGroupHelper
 
- 	contextCreateHelper    contextCreateACIHelper
 
- }
 
- func (suite *ContextSuiteTest) BeforeTest(suiteName, testName string) {
 
- 	suite.mockUserSelector = &MockUserSelector{}
 
- 	suite.mockResourceGroupHeper = &MockResourceGroupHelper{}
 
- 	suite.contextCreateHelper = contextCreateACIHelper{
 
- 		suite.mockUserSelector,
 
- 		suite.mockResourceGroupHeper,
 
- 	}
 
- }
 
- func (suite *ContextSuiteTest) TestCreateSpecifiedSubscriptionAndGroup() {
 
- 	ctx := context.TODO()
 
- 	opts := options("1234", "myResourceGroup")
 
- 	suite.mockResourceGroupHeper.On("GetGroup", ctx, "1234", "myResourceGroup").Return(group("myResourceGroup", "eastus"), nil)
 
- 	data, description, err := suite.contextCreateHelper.createContextData(ctx, opts)
 
- 	Expect(err).To(BeNil())
 
- 	Expect(description).To(Equal("myResourceGroup@eastus"))
 
- 	Expect(data).To(Equal(aciContext("1234", "myResourceGroup", "eastus")))
 
- }
 
- func (suite *ContextSuiteTest) TestErrorOnNonExistentResourceGroup() {
 
- 	ctx := context.TODO()
 
- 	opts := options("1234", "myResourceGroup")
 
- 	notFoundError := errors.New(`Not Found: "myResourceGroup"`)
 
- 	suite.mockResourceGroupHeper.On("GetGroup", ctx, "1234", "myResourceGroup").Return(resources.Group{}, notFoundError)
 
- 	data, description, err := suite.contextCreateHelper.createContextData(ctx, opts)
 
- 	Expect(data).To(BeNil())
 
- 	Expect(description).To(Equal(""))
 
- 	Expect(err.Error()).To(Equal("Could not find resource group \"myResourceGroup\": Not Found: \"myResourceGroup\""))
 
- }
 
- func (suite *ContextSuiteTest) TestCreateNewResourceGroup() {
 
- 	ctx := context.TODO()
 
- 	opts := options("1234", "")
 
- 	suite.mockResourceGroupHeper.On("GetGroup", ctx, "1234", "myResourceGroup").Return(group("myResourceGroup", "eastus"), nil)
 
- 	selectOptions := []string{"create a new resource group", "group1 (eastus)", "group2 (westeurope)"}
 
- 	suite.mockUserSelector.On("userSelect", "Select a resource group", selectOptions).Return(0, nil)
 
- 	suite.mockResourceGroupHeper.On("CreateOrUpdate", ctx, "1234", mock.AnythingOfType("string"), mock.AnythingOfType("resources.Group")).Return(group("newResourceGroup", "eastus"), nil)
 
- 	suite.mockResourceGroupHeper.On("ListGroups", ctx, "1234").Return([]resources.Group{
 
- 		group("group1", "eastus"),
 
- 		group("group2", "westeurope"),
 
- 	}, nil)
 
- 	data, description, err := suite.contextCreateHelper.createContextData(ctx, opts)
 
- 	Expect(err).To(BeNil())
 
- 	Expect(description).To(Equal("newResourceGroup@eastus"))
 
- 	Expect(data).To(Equal(aciContext("1234", "newResourceGroup", "eastus")))
 
- }
 
- func (suite *ContextSuiteTest) TestSelectExistingResourceGroup() {
 
- 	ctx := context.TODO()
 
- 	opts := options("1234", "")
 
- 	selectOptions := []string{"create a new resource group", "group1 (eastus)", "group2 (westeurope)"}
 
- 	suite.mockUserSelector.On("userSelect", "Select a resource group", selectOptions).Return(2, nil)
 
- 	suite.mockResourceGroupHeper.On("ListGroups", ctx, "1234").Return([]resources.Group{
 
- 		group("group1", "eastus"),
 
- 		group("group2", "westeurope"),
 
- 	}, nil)
 
- 	data, description, err := suite.contextCreateHelper.createContextData(ctx, opts)
 
- 	Expect(err).To(BeNil())
 
- 	Expect(description).To(Equal("group2@westeurope"))
 
- 	Expect(data).To(Equal(aciContext("1234", "group2", "westeurope")))
 
- }
 
- func (suite *ContextSuiteTest) TestSelectSingleSubscriptionIdAndExistingResourceGroup() {
 
- 	ctx := context.TODO()
 
- 	opts := options("", "")
 
- 	suite.mockResourceGroupHeper.On("GetSubscriptionIDs", ctx).Return([]subscription.Model{subModel("123456", "Subscription1")}, nil)
 
- 	selectOptions := []string{"create a new resource group", "group1 (eastus)", "group2 (westeurope)"}
 
- 	suite.mockUserSelector.On("userSelect", "Select a resource group", selectOptions).Return(2, nil)
 
- 	suite.mockResourceGroupHeper.On("ListGroups", ctx, "123456").Return([]resources.Group{
 
- 		group("group1", "eastus"),
 
- 		group("group2", "westeurope"),
 
- 	}, nil)
 
- 	data, description, err := suite.contextCreateHelper.createContextData(ctx, opts)
 
- 	Expect(err).To(BeNil())
 
- 	Expect(description).To(Equal("group2@westeurope"))
 
- 	Expect(data).To(Equal(aciContext("123456", "group2", "westeurope")))
 
- }
 
- func (suite *ContextSuiteTest) TestSelectSubscriptionIdAndExistingResourceGroup() {
 
- 	ctx := context.TODO()
 
- 	opts := options("", "")
 
- 	sub1 := subModel("1234", "Subscription1")
 
- 	sub2 := subModel("5678", "Subscription2")
 
- 	suite.mockResourceGroupHeper.On("GetSubscriptionIDs", ctx).Return([]subscription.Model{sub1, sub2}, nil)
 
- 	selectOptions := []string{"Subscription1(1234)", "Subscription2(5678)"}
 
- 	suite.mockUserSelector.On("userSelect", "Select a subscription ID", selectOptions).Return(1, nil)
 
- 	selectOptions = []string{"create a new resource group", "group1 (eastus)", "group2 (westeurope)"}
 
- 	suite.mockUserSelector.On("userSelect", "Select a resource group", selectOptions).Return(2, nil)
 
- 	suite.mockResourceGroupHeper.On("ListGroups", ctx, "5678").Return([]resources.Group{
 
- 		group("group1", "eastus"),
 
- 		group("group2", "westeurope"),
 
- 	}, nil)
 
- 	data, description, err := suite.contextCreateHelper.createContextData(ctx, opts)
 
- 	Expect(err).To(BeNil())
 
- 	Expect(description).To(Equal("group2@westeurope"))
 
- 	Expect(data).To(Equal(aciContext("5678", "group2", "westeurope")))
 
- }
 
- func subModel(subID string, display string) subscription.Model {
 
- 	return subscription.Model{
 
- 		SubscriptionID: to.StringPtr(subID),
 
- 		DisplayName:    to.StringPtr(display),
 
- 	}
 
- }
 
- func group(groupName string, location string) resources.Group {
 
- 	return resources.Group{
 
- 		Name:     to.StringPtr(groupName),
 
- 		Location: to.StringPtr(location),
 
- 	}
 
- }
 
- func aciContext(subscriptionID string, resourceGroupName string, location string) store.AciContext {
 
- 	return store.AciContext{
 
- 		SubscriptionID: subscriptionID,
 
- 		Location:       location,
 
- 		ResourceGroup:  resourceGroupName,
 
- 	}
 
- }
 
- func options(subscriptionID string, resourceGroupName string) map[string]string {
 
- 	return map[string]string{
 
- 		"aciSubscriptionID": subscriptionID,
 
- 		"aciResourceGroup":  resourceGroupName,
 
- 	}
 
- }
 
- func TestContextSuite(t *testing.T) {
 
- 	RegisterTestingT(t)
 
- 	suite.Run(t, new(ContextSuiteTest))
 
- }
 
- type MockUserSelector struct {
 
- 	mock.Mock
 
- }
 
- func (s *MockUserSelector) userSelect(message string, options []string) (int, error) {
 
- 	args := s.Called(message, options)
 
- 	return args.Int(0), args.Error(1)
 
- }
 
- type MockResourceGroupHelper struct {
 
- 	mock.Mock
 
- }
 
- func (s *MockResourceGroupHelper) GetSubscriptionIDs(ctx context.Context) ([]subscription.Model, error) {
 
- 	args := s.Called(ctx)
 
- 	return args.Get(0).([]subscription.Model), args.Error(1)
 
- }
 
- func (s *MockResourceGroupHelper) ListGroups(ctx context.Context, subscriptionID string) ([]resources.Group, error) {
 
- 	args := s.Called(ctx, subscriptionID)
 
- 	return args.Get(0).([]resources.Group), args.Error(1)
 
- }
 
- func (s *MockResourceGroupHelper) GetGroup(ctx context.Context, subscriptionID string, groupName string) (resources.Group, error) {
 
- 	args := s.Called(ctx, subscriptionID, groupName)
 
- 	return args.Get(0).(resources.Group), args.Error(1)
 
- }
 
- func (s *MockResourceGroupHelper) CreateOrUpdate(ctx context.Context, subscriptionID string, resourceGroupName string, parameters resources.Group) (result resources.Group, err error) {
 
- 	args := s.Called(ctx, subscriptionID, resourceGroupName, parameters)
 
- 	return args.Get(0).(resources.Group), args.Error(1)
 
- }
 
- func (s *MockResourceGroupHelper) Delete(ctx context.Context, subscriptionID string, resourceGroupName string) (err error) {
 
- 	args := s.Called(ctx, subscriptionID, resourceGroupName)
 
- 	return args.Error(0)
 
- }
